I saw one time in this forum that someone suggest to put a capacitor in parallel with the DC motor which is driven by H-bridges to remove EMI. I am working on the exact same circuit right now, 12V DC motor, ~1A current consumption, MOSFET h-bridge, 25KHz PWM, ~40% duty cycle. When I put 0.1uF cap, the motor stopped turning. Without the cap, everything looks fine.
I have few knowledge about EMI. Could anyone explain in more detail about the function of the cap and EMI? How to choose the cap, capacitance, type?
